EFFECTS OF VARIETIES AND PHOSPHORUS RATES ON THE GROWTH AND YIELD OF SOYBEAN (Glycine max (L) Merrill) IN GOMBE SUDAN SAVANNA

Abstract

Field experiment was conducted during the 2023 rainy season at Teaching and Research Farm of the Faculty of Agriculture, Federal University of Kashere (Latitude 90 54’ 46’’N, Longitude 110 0’ 27’’E at 431 m above the sea level) Akko Local Government Area, Gombe State and at the Teaching and Research Farm of Federal College of Horticulture Dadinkowa, Yamaltu-Deba Local Government Area, Gombe State, Latitude 100 18’E and Longitude 11030 N and altitude of 218m above sea level. The treatments consisted of two varieties of soybean (TGX-1951 and TGX1448-2E) and four phosphorus rates (0, 20, 40 and 60 kg/ha), these were laid out in a Randomized Complete Block Design (RCBD) with four replications. Results of the study showed that soybean variety TGX1448-2E and 60 kg/ha of phosphorus rate significantly gave higher pod yield over TGX-1951 and the other phosphorus rates. The control treatment of no phosphorus applied significantly gave lower pod yield in this study. TGX1448-2E and phosphorus rate of 60 kg/ha should be used by farmers who grow soybean based from their performances in terms of pod yield from the study areas.
